Genus plc ("Genus" or the "Group")

Appointment of new Financial Adviser and joint Corporate Broker

Genus (LSE: GNS), a leading global animal genetics company, announces the appointment of J.P. Morgan Securities plc (which conducts its UK investment banking business as J.P. Morgan Cazenove) as its Financial Adviser and joint Corporate Broker, alongside Peel Hunt and Panmure Liberum, with immediate effect.

About Genus

Genus is a world-leading animal genetics company. Genus creates advances in animal breeding and genetic improvement by applying biotechnology and sells added value products for livestock farming and food producers. Its technology is applicable across livestock species and is currently commercialised by Genus in the dairy, beef and pork food production sectors.

Genus's worldwide sales are made in over seventy-five countries under the trademarks 'ABS' (dairy and beef cattle) and 'PIC' (pigs) and comprise semen, embryos and breeding animals with superior genetics to those animals currently in farms. Genus's customers' animals produce offspring with greater production efficiency, and quality, and use these to supply the global dairy and meat supply chains.

The Group's competitive edge has been created from the ownership and control of proprietary lines of breeding animals, the biotechnology used to improve them and its global supply chain, technical service and sales and distribution network. The PRP is a market leading innovation in gene editing, which Genus is looking to commercialise in the porcine industry once regulatory approval is gained.

With headquarters in Basingstoke, United Kingdom, Genus companies operate in over twenty-five countries on six continents, with research laboratories located in Madison, Wisconsin, USA.
